- Abstract
- en_US The covers of this typical early twentieth-century British children's fable book are pictorial boards, and both are well done. On the front, the fox runs from the well where, presumably, he has left the wolf; on the back, the fox is on tiptoes trying to reach the grapes. The colored frontispiece of WC is by Ethel Tanner; it is becoming detached from the block. There are black-and-white illustrations on the right-hand pages at regular four-page intervals, ranging from partial to full-page. Most are signed S, but there seems to be no other indication of who that person might be. Several of these illustrations are unusually well done. Notice in particular FG, CJ, The Stag in the Oxstall, DS, The Fox and the Mask, and The Wolf and the Sheep. That last story is also well told. There are no page numbers, T of C or AI. The title-fable appears first and helps, with its illustration, to make sense of the front cover's picture. I would rate this fragile book as a very lucky find!
